  7. Extract text from Emails | GroupDocs

    To extract a text from emails getText method is used. This method allows to extract a text from the entire Document. Pagination and raw mode is not supported for emails. Here are the steps to extract a text from an email: Instantiate Parser object for the initial email; Call getText method and obtain TextReader object; Read a text from reader.
